It’s been a wet week for #30DaysOfBiking and also a very busy week at work, and so I missed a bunch of days.

And on our way into personal training at Movati, Sarah and I spotted this sign below. A very cheerful woman at the front desk saw us looking at it and said, hey I’m teaching the Glow ride on Saturday. You should come. It’ll be fun.

So that’s where I was this morning. (Sarah was off helping to put in the docks at the Guelph Community Boating Club. That’s a different kind of workout that involves waders.)

How was the Glow Ride? I liked the aesthetics–dark with glow sticks. The instructor was friendly and helpful. I love that they offer earplugs if you’re concerned about the loud music. I didn’t take them, but I liked that they were on offer.

Movati has new bikes which display all the things: power, cadence, speed, and distance. They’re easy to adjust for seat height. As usual, I hate all the dancing around on the bike. I’m also not a fan of upper-body exercises on the bike with tiny weights. But there was lots of the stuff I do like, climbing and sprinting. I didn’t have any bad effects with my hiatal hernia but I made sure to eat a few hours before the class, not right before. I also didn’t do anything too intense. See here for why.

Anyway, it’s a very rainy weekend and we’re back to chores and weekday work stuff that’s spilled over, way over, into the weekend. But it felt good to get some movement in.
